A focus on efficiency

Cost-cutting has become the watchword. The Government's Comprehensive Spending Review (CSR) has had the expected negative impact on the funding available for most public services. And the effects are being felt by not-for-profit organisations too. Which is why now, more than ever, achieving greater efficiency is the priority for many in this sector.

Public sector

Pressure to reduce operating costs is particularly difficult to respond to for those organisations that rely heavily on cash or cheque payments. And the same goes for organisations that use call centres to receive payments, where admin requirements are high. One effective way to reduce costs is by opening up new channels to take payments.

Not-for-profit sector

Charities and 'third sector' organisations have also been hit hard by the spending cuts. Although donations from the public have held up surprisingly well, the expectation is for administration costs to be kept to a minimum. And there's been a notable fall in donations from younger donors, aged 18-24.

Simple multi-channel payment options

Our terminals and virtual solutions work across a wide variety of channels, giving you greater scope when accepting payments.

Quicker with contactless

Our contactless technology not only speeds up payments, but can help you move towards a cashless environment. Allowing payments of £15 or under to be accepted in less than half a second, it's particularly well-suited to universities and colleges who wish to achieve 'cashless campus' status. And local authorities can benefit from contactless parking opportunities.

In person

Process sales, refunds, and purchases with cashback with our colour-display terminals. Our classic terminals are perfect for accepting payments from a traditional till point, while our portable terminals, usable up to 100m from the base give you the freedom to take the terminal to the payee.

On the move

Our mobile terminals use a GPRS system that finds the strongest signal from three networks to accept card payments almost anywhere, making them an ideal solution for fundraisers and conferences.

Card-not-present payments

Our range of ePDQ solutions offer a reliable, safe and fully PCI DSS compliant way to accept card payments online, over the phone or by mail order around the clock, for services such as council tax, fines, permits and licences. You can handle settlement and keep on top of sales through online Management Information reports and regular statements. Online, our e-commerce solutions integrates seamlessly into your existing website payment pages. Or use our simple web-based virtual terminal to accept payments over the phone or by mail, with real-time authorisation.

International payments

Barclaycard SmartPay is a PCI DSS compliant online payment gateway for pan-European transactions and payment processing services. Simple and secure, it allows you to offer localised payment pages and payment options for the international market – a perfect solution for overseas students, for example.

Open up new income opportunities

If your organisation has a retail outlet – a charity shop, or staff café, for example – or processes transactions from foreign cards, our additional services can provide new sources of income.

Dynamic Currency Conversion

When selling to foreign visitors or students, Dynamic Currency Conversion benefits both you and those customers. They'll see their purchases in up to 21 local currencies, accounting for 87% of foreign card turnover¹ as well as sterling, and choose which one to pay with. And you'll receive a share of the foreign exchange commission.

Prepaid solutions

There's plenty of flexibility with pre-paid cards. They can be offered as traditional gift cards, encouraging new custom. Or they can be used in a more bespoke way – for example, allowing end-users to pay in advance for products and services they regularly purchase from you, or for controlling spend on a bursary card.

Mobile phone top-ups

Another potential income stream for retail outlets is commission earned on mobile phone top-ups processed through your terminal. With 62% of all UK mobiles being pay-as-you-go², top-ups can be a powerful way to boost income, increase footfall and drive loyalty.
